After nearly four months of searching, the Postville meatpacking plant that was the site of a massive May immigration raid has named a new chief executive officer.

“Within the coming days, or lets say a week or two, we will suspend our supervision unless there’s new management in place,” Rabbi Menachem Genack, the head of kosher supervision for the Orthodox Union, told the Jewish Telegraphic Agency this afternoon.

The Iowa Attorney General’s Office has filed a criminal complaint and affidavit today in Allamakee County District Court listing more than 9,000 alleged violations of Iowa child labor laws at Agriprocessors in Postville.

Anyone driving on Lawler Street in downtown Postville Sunday might have found it difficult to find a common thread between the two groups shouting phrases about immigration from opposite sides of the street. Yet, members of the immigration debate who hold opposing viewpoints on many of the difficult nuances of the debate do hold common ground: Employers should not be given a free pass.

Answering media inquiries and consulting with an attorney wasn’t exactly how Rabbi Morris Allen wanted to spend his vacation. When he learned, however, that someone associated with a New York-based public relations firm hired by Agriprocessors was impersonating him online, he knew his vacation plans were subject to change.
